Considering One Fifty Braid (Wesgroup) — honest tenant experiences? by AV-Tactics in NewWest

[–]Jaded_Objective_447 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I've only lived here off and on since mid Dec ( got my apartment mid Dec but didn't fully move in until NYE. Management has been very responsive to the few things I've needed ( like I lost my mailbox key the 1st week 🤦. They had a new one for me in a couple of days). I think the train noise is probably less the higher you go. I am on a low level and face the skytrain and tracks and it's loud, though the soundproofing helps a lot. It doesn't bother me though because I grew up next to train tracks, and my kids adjusted within a week or so. The cleaners as someone else mentioned are constantly here and there is management 7 days a week, though I think just one on weekends. The fob everywhere is overkill compared to other places, but it's nice too. I feel safe even walking my dog in the neighborhood at midnight when he gets a wild hair up his ass. Haven't gotten a utility bill yet so I don't know. I've talked to people who were here during the summer and they said the central ac works great they didn't have any issues. As someone mentioned there is gas stations, not too far away up the hill is 7/11, a bruncheria, bunch of other small food places. If you go in the other direction across the tracks there is a good Korean place. You can walk or take the train 1 stop to sapperton and there are restaurants and a save on there or as someone else said take the train to New Westminster for Safeway and other shopping. I don't hear noise from my neighbors, occasionally will hear noise from the hallway if people are being really loud 🤷 The overnight parking for guests has to be reserved at least 24 hours in advance and you get the pass from the office, it's 10$ night. You get 1 daytime visitor pass with your apartment, it's good for 4 hours at a time only. They definitely do have people towed.

As far as the building, the amenities are pretty nice. We have a dog wash, car wash, amazing gym, co working area, game room, theater/media room, outdoor pizza oven/gas grille area, garden boxes (not many and sign up is 1st come 1st serve), dog area and a coffee bar area. Tenants also get free telehealth with Cleveland clinic and there is a telehealth room with all the diagnostic stuff you call in from There is a guest suite you can rent for out of town guests. You can rent a parking spot in garage, and a small storage unit. So far the building management seems great, and I've seen the cleaners throughout the building frequently. I really haven't heard any noise in our unit unless someone is right outside our door, and of course train noise but that's a given and it's not as bad as I expected - and our unit faces the trains. The materials seem quality, having a washer/dryer in the unit is great and again brand new.
